If you are looking for International Coaching Federation (ICF) credentialing, a minimum of 10-hour group mentor coaching is required for applying to and renewing ICF credentials for ACC (Associate Certified Coach), PCC (Professional Certified Coach), and MCC (Master Certified Coach). A mentor coaching program provides coaching as well as mentoring to the mentee coach. In coaching, the mentor coach explores with the mentee their vision and perspective of their practice, strengths, and areas of development, while in mentoring, the mentor coach provides feedback and input in a constructive manner. The mentor coach often listens to recorded coaching sessions that the mentee would have sent before the commencement of the session.   

  

Mentor coaching serves as a powerful tool for coaches to elevate their practice and meet the highest standards of the coaching industry. It enhances the mentees coaching skills, broadens their knowledge, and gains new insights about their coaching practice.
